Beauty brand Milk Makeup is selling a $440 lipstick set it made with Wu-Tang Clan, and people can't get past the price

Wu-Tang Clan and Milk Makeup announced a limited-edition line with eight shades of $55 lipstick. The line also includes a $75 Wu-Tang Clan mirror.

Collaborations are extremely popular in the beauty industry. 2018 alone has seen Colourpop collaborate with Disney, the Museum of Ice Cream work with Sephora, and Crayola create a line for ASOS.

The latest group to join the ever-growing list of collaborators are Wu-Tang Clan and Milk Makeup. On Friday, the hip-hop group and cruelty-free cosmetics brand announced a limited-edition line that features eight shades of $55 lipstick.

The pin set features three pins designed to look like the Wu-Tang Clan logo, the collaboration logo, and a gold infinity sign.

The mirror, however, is particularly striking, as it's shaped to look like the Wu-Tang Clan logo and is plated with 24-carat gold.

Wu-Tang Clan member RZA spoke to Billboard about the collaboration, and said that the lipstick line was inspired by his wife and a shared love for New York City.
